Side-by-side comparison of PL25 St. austell and PL29 Port isaac covering house prices, crime, schools, broadband, council tax, green space and energy performance.
PL25 is the more affordable option at £250,000 median vs £425,000 in PL29. PL29 has lower recorded crime (95 vs 2,909 offences over 13 months). PL25 has notably better broadband connectivity.
| Metric | PL25 St. austell | PL29 Port isaac |
|---|---|---|
| Median House Price | £250,000 | £425,000 |
| Band D Council Tax | £2,591 | £2,591 |
| Total Crimes (13 months) | 2,909 | 95 |
| Outstanding Schools | 1.0 | — |
| Broadband Score (/100) | 36.0 | 8.7 |
| Green Space Access (%) | 89.4 | 28.8 |
| EPC Median Score | 70.0 | 50.0 |
